About the role
- The Research Assistant will work with Dr.
- Julie Price on collaborative studies at Massachusetts General Brigham, Harvard Medical School.
- Our group investigates alterations in brain function, structure, and molecular pathology in normal aging, Parkinson's disease, Alzheimer's disease, and Down Syndrome.
Responsibilities
- Work closely with Principal Investigators and Project Manager, will manage and implement rigorous quality assurance protocols across assigned studies.
- Manage researcher access to raw and processed imaging data as well as measures derived from neuroimaging data
- Oversee the day-to-day functioning of in-house neuroimage processing pipelines, providing high level support and troubleshooting problematic cases, for assigned studies
- Work with researchers to develop and implement statistical data analytics and visualizations in service of research aims.
